“Spark Joy: How to Use the KonMari Method to Declutter Kids’ Belongings”

Hello and welcome to our Minimalism and Decluttering website! Today, we are going to talk about using the KonMari method to help kids declutter their belongings. Marie Kondo’s approach has gained popularity for its practical and effective strategies in tidying up spaces, but how can we apply it when it comes to children? Let’s find out!
The first step is involving your child in the process. Sit down with them and explain why decluttering is important. Teach them that having fewer things allows for a more organized and peaceful environment. Encourage them to take ownership of their space.
Next, follow the KonMari principle of sorting by category rather than location. Start with clothing, then move on to toys, books, art supplies, etc. Gather all items from each category into one place so your child can see everything they have.
Now comes the fun part – spark joy! Ask your child to hold each item individually and decide whether it brings them joy or not. Encourage them to trust their feelings and make decisions based on what truly makes them happy.
For younger children who may struggle with this concept, try asking questions like “Does this toy make you smile?” or “Do you love wearing this shirt?” By focusing on positive emotions associated with each item, they will gradually develop a better understanding of what sparks joy in their lives.
Once your child has selected the items that bring joy, assist them in finding proper storage solutions. Ensure everything has a designated place where it can be easily accessed and put away after use.
Lastly, establish routines for maintenance. Help your child understand that keeping things tidy is an ongoing process by setting aside regular times for organizing sessions together as a family.
Remember that teaching kids about minimalism goes beyond just decluttering their belongings; it lays the foundation for lifelong habits of intentional living. By involving children in these processes early on, you are providing valuable lessons that will benefit them throughout their lives.
